Plain-English summary
Yelloh! Classic Vanilla Nut Sundae Cones (4 fl oz, UPC 810038684895) manufactured by Totally Cool, Inc. are being recalled because of possible contamination with Listeria monocytogenes, a bacterium that can cause serious infection.
Approximately 5,885 cases have been distributed nationwide. The affected product codes range from 6T3227 to 6T4157. Each case contains 24 cones wrapped in paper and packaged in a cardboard box (8 boxes per case).
Consumers should not eat this product. Affected packages should be disposed of or returned to the retailer where purchased.
